alternative, more advanced option is to extend directly from this class and override methods as necessary remembering
to add @Configuration to the subclass and @Bean to overridden @Bean
methods. For more details see the Javadoc of @EnableWs.
This class registers the following EndpointMappings:
PayloadRootAnnotationMethodEndpointMapping ordered at 0 for mapping requests to
@PayloadRoot annotated controller methods.
SoapActionAnnotationMethodEndpointMapping ordered at 1 for mapping requests to
@SoapAction annotated controller methods.
AnnotationActionEndpointMapping ordered at 2 for mapping requests to @Action annotated
controller methods.
Registers one EndpointAdapter:
DefaultMethodEndpointAdapter for processing requests with annotated endpoint methods.
Registers the following EndpointExceptionResolvers:
SoapFaultAnnotationExceptionResolver for handling exceptions annotated with @SoapFault.
SimpleSoapExceptionResolver for creating default exceptions.
